WebOn Linux I can isolate a CPU set that removes all processes from any thread/core or grouping. This removes everything including the kernel, user, and networking processes from the isolated CPU set. Then I can manually reassign/pin processes to the isolated CPU set. The scheduler will manage both sets independently and adjust the context switch ... WebMar 4, 2024 · This process requires a lot of precision, but not as much as the previous steps. The CPU die is mounted to a silicon board, and electrical connections are run to all of the pins that make contact with the motherboard. Modern CPUs can have thousands of pins, with the high-end AMD Threadripper having 4094 of them. WebSep 2, 2024 · SYSCPU: The CPU usage by the process while system handling. USRCPU: The CPU usage by the process while running in user mode. VGROW: The amount of virtual memory the process has occupied since the last output update. RGROW: The amount of physical memory the process has occupied since the last output update. WebIntel 8008: The Intel 8008, originally called the 1201, was one of the first microprocessors ever developed. The chip originally appeared in 1972 and carried a price tag of $120.00. It served as the heart of the Mark-8 hobby computer, described by graduate student Jonathan Titus in the July 1974 issue of Radio-Electronics magazine. The Intel ...
